Baku's Response to Yerevan's Latest Proposals on Peace Agreement: Safaryan Responds
Baku has yet to respond to the latest proposals from official Yerevan regarding the peace agreement. This was stated by Deputy Foreign Minister Mnatsakan Safaryan during a briefing with reporters in the National Assembly.
“We will indicate when there is a response,” Safaryan replied.
He also declined to provide details about the recent meeting of members of the Armenian-Azerbaijani demarcation and delimitation commission.
It is noteworthy that on November 21, the Armenian side submitted its sixth proposal concerning the pe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an to the Azerbaijani side.
